Before hanging something on a roof or wall, what should you do?

Before hanging something on a roof or wall, looking behind is crucial because it ensures safety by checking for any hidden electrical lines, plumbing pipes, or structural elements that could be damaged or pose a risk during the hanging process. This step is essential to avoid accidents or costly repairs that can arise from unexpected obstacles.

Additionally, ensuring that you are aware of the surroundings and potential hazards contributes to a safer working environment. While other actions, such as checking the weather or measuring height, can be important in certain scenarios, they do not address the immediate safety and potential damage issues that could arise from what is located behind the wall or roof surface. Thus, confirming that the area behind the surface is clear is the most critical step before proceeding with any hanging task.
